随着信息技术的迅速发展,虚拟化技术在操作系统中的应用显得愈加重要。虚拟化技术能够将多个虚拟机并行运行在同一物理服务器上,实现资源的最大化利用,提升系统的灵活性和可扩展性。在现代数据中心,虚拟化不仅有效降低了硬件成本,还带来了更高的系统管理效率。通过合理的虚拟机管理,企业能够迅速响应市场变化,优化资源配置,从而保持竞争优势。本文将详细探讨虚拟化技术在操作系统中的应用,如何实现高效的虚拟机管理,并为读者提供实用的解决方案。

虚拟化技术的核心在于其能够抽象出物理硬件资源,使得多个操作系统可以共享同一台物理机。这种技术可以通过虚拟机监控器或虚拟机管理程序来实现,最常见的有VMware ESXi、Microsoft Hyper-V以及KVM等。这些平台为虚拟机的创建、删除、迁移以及监控提供了强大的支持。管理人员只需通过简单的界面操作,即可实现对虚拟机的全面掌控。
在进行虚拟机管理时,资源调度是一个非常重要的环节。通过高效的资源调度算法,可以合理分配CPU、内存及网络带宽等资源,确保虚拟机的高可用性和性能。动态负载均衡技术的引入,使得虚拟资源能够依据实际需求进行灵活调整,避免了资源的闲置与浪费,提高了整体的资源利用率。
安全性也是虚拟机管理不可忽视的方面。虚拟机的隔离特性使得不同虚拟机之间可以相对独立,从而减少了安全风险。企业可以通过设置虚拟防火墙、入侵检测系统等手段,进一步确保虚拟环境的安全性。定期的安全更新和漏洞扫描也是维护虚拟环境安全的必要措施。
监控与维护是高效虚拟机管理的重要组成部分。利用专用的监控工具,企业能够实时跟踪虚拟机的性能指标,如CPU使用率、内存占用、网络流量等。通过及时发现和处理潜在问题,可以避免系统异常导致的业务损失。定期的备份与恢复策略也能保障数据的安全性,从而为企业的持续发展提供有力支撑。
虚拟化技术在操作系统中的应用不仅提高了资源利用率,还带来了灵活的管理方式。在这个快速发展的数字时代,与时俱进地掌握虚拟机管理技术,将为企业的稳健运营提供强有力的支持。
